Graveside service: 11 a.m. Saturday in Mount Olivet Cemetery.
Memorials: Emory J. Lilge House, Community Hospice of Texas at Huguley, Burleson, Texas 76028, in Mr. Simmons' memory in lieu of flowers.
Phil E. Simmons Sr. was born June 8, 1930, in Nocona and had resided in Haltom City for 50 years. He retired from Crown Cork and Seal in 1982.
Survivors: Wife of 46 years, Betty Sue Simmons of Haltom City; sons, Phil E. Simmons Jr. and his wife, Jeri, Richard "Dicky" Simmons and his wife, Pam, and M. David Simmons; six grandchildren; one great-grandson; and many loving family members and friends.
